Abstract
894,146. Intruder alarms, DE HAVILLAND AIRCRAFT CO. Ltd. Oct. 21, 1960 [Nov. 5, 1959], No. 37513/59. Class 118. A rotating narrow beam of radiation (preferably infra-red) from a source 12 (Fig. 1) or 62 (Fig. 5) is reflected from stationary reflectors 16 (Fig. 1) or 66 (Fig. 5) as a series of radiation pulses to a detector 14 (Fig. 1) or 70 (Fig. 5); output signals from the detector are compared with a series of electrical signals corresponding to the radiation pulses, and an alarm is given when the output signals are interrupted. The beam of radiation may be produced by a lamp co-operating with a rotating reflector or with a rotating shutter having an eccentric aperture. The shutter may also include magnetized areas which co-operate with a stationary pick-up to produce the series of electrical signals corresponding to the radiation pulses.
